リンクをクリップボードにコピー
コピー完了
「地図上の特定の場所に多角形のスライスを作成。ビヘイビアのスワップイメージを選択して、スライス上にマウスが置かれると地図の横に関連データが出る。マウスをそこから外すとデータは消える。」
これをDreamweaverで作成し、右下のライブビューアイコンからブラウザを選択(chromeやfirefox,edgeなど)して動作確認をして正確に動くことを確認した上で保存した。実際のブラウザを起動して見たところ、マウスはその位置で手のひらアイコンに変わるが、データは出ない。クリックすると画面は消えて真っ黒背景にデータが出現する。上の←をクリックすると元の地図に戻る。
この現象を修正したいのですがどうすれば良いのでしょうか。(Dreamweaver2021)
リンクをクリップボードにコピー
コピー完了
実際のサイトに、マウスが重なった時に表示する画像ファイルがアップロードされていないのではないでしょうか。画像やリンク先のファイルは、Dreamweaverで設定する「ローカルルートフォルダ」の中に保存するようにし、実際のサイトと階層が同じになるようにアップロードする必要があります。
また、フォルダやファイル名に日本語や記号が含まれていると誤動作する原因になります。必ず半角英数字のみを使うようにしてください。
リンクをクリップボードにコピー
コピー完了
nmatsuo5さん、返信頂きありがとうございました。
データが出現する処に元のイメージのファイルを置きました("image1.png")
、その同じ場所に全ての地図上の各関連データ(**.png)を置くようにしました。元のイメージとデータの表イメージは全てサイズが同じにしました。日本語や記号は一切使用せず半角英数字です。又、階層は両者同じ階層にあります。
Dreamweaver上でリアルタイムプレビューで確認すると狙った効果通りにデータが出現します。(chrome edge forefoxいずれも) 地図上の特定の場所のデータがその都度出現します。 でも実際のブラウザでは手のひらアイコンに変わるだけで何も起こらないのです。クリックすると別のページに変わってデータが出るのです。
リンクをクリップボードにコピー
コピー完了
うーん、ひとまず思い当たる原因はそれくらいなんですが、既にサイトに公開されているのであればURLをお知らせいただけないでしょうか。実際のコード内容を拝見して原因を探してみたいと思います。